    Hi Jothi,
    All the content relevant to maintaining the portal is organized and Developed in Portal content Development.The Portal Content Object Model consist of content objects such as these:
                                          u2022 iViews
                                          u2022 Pages
                                          u2022 Worksets
                                          u2022 Roles
                                          u2022 Layouts
    One of the main components of the portal architecture is the Portal Content Directory in which all the content required to maintain the portal is stored and maintained. The Portal Content Directory is the central place to
                        u2022 create various content objects
                        u2022 administer them by assigning permissions and changing their properties

    Parallel threads are easy in Labview.  You just create two loops where the output of either loop is not connected to the input of the other.  Without this data dependency, the two loops run in parallel.  See the attached vi, my producer-consumer template.  Replace the random number generator in the top loop with your serial port code.  Put your other processing code in the bottom loop.  Use the queue to pass info from one loop to the other.  You can signal the lower loop when the serial port receiving is done by putting something on the queue that signifies the completion (like a "done" string).  Your lower loop will constantly check the queue, looking for the "done" string.  You can use a boolean if you remove the string wires and replace them with boolean types.
    Bytes at Port will look at the serial port buffer and report the number of bytes sitting there waiting to be read.  Call it before you read, and pass the number from bytes at port to the read function.  Search the LV examples for serial port and you will see how bytes at port is used.

    Ramesh ,
    There are several approches to your problem . Before that let me say , "ECC 6.0 should be done completely in java " is not a right assumption because ECC is built on ABAP stack so the application / programs within the ECC should be developed in ABAP .
    Coming to your problem , if you want to develop reports in java accessing the backend SAP ECC , as per the NW04s , you could have a look at the following IT scenario
    http://help.sap.com/saphelp_nw2004s/helpdata/en/f5/416c4255b3c553e10000000a1550b0/frameset.htm
    The easiest method is using visual composer , pls have a look at this
    http://help.sap.com/saphelp_nw2004s/helpdata/en/44/6bb4dfce353673e10000000a114a6b/content.htm
    More complex application can be developed using webdynpro technology ( again you could use webdynpro for java or abap ) as apposed to SAP 's earlier approach ( using HTMLB , JSP , JSPDynpage etc - Abstract component etc.... mentioned by sukanto will be in this category  ). Webdynpro is the strategcal UI development technology for SAP because of its numerous advantages

    Visual Composer as Modelling Tool
    Models designed in Visual Composer can be deployed to run in one or more technology engines, including SAP HTML/B and Flex. The same model can be deployed to more than one environment, although not all components and controls are fully supported in each. Visual Composer implements a proprietary XML-based Visual Composer Language as its source code for creating the models. Only at deployment is the model actually compiled into the executable code required by the selected UI technology. The result is a model once run
    anywhere capability.The models that you build in Visual Composer are generated in Generic Modeling Language (GML) code. To deploy your application to a portal, the GML code
    must be compiled into a language supported by the portal. During compilation, warnings and possible errors may be discovered, enabling you to check the model validity. The compiled content is deployed directly to the portal, in the runtimeenvironment that you select.In runtime, transactional content can run through HTML/B and Flex, while
    analytic content which may require a more animated environment may run through Flex. The models deployed by Visual Composer to the portal include runtime metadata, which is stored with the model in the PCD and exported in the business package, for delivery to customers.
